29 CFR 1926.405(a)(2)(ii)(I): Flexible cords and cables used for temporary wiring were not protected from physical damage:   a. Montgomery Ridge Development, Autumn Lane, Skillman, NJ - Bldg 801  Employees engaged in masonry activities used a flexible cord that was not protected from physical damage.  Employees ran a flexible power cord from building 16, across a paved roadway, to building 8 to provided power for portable hand tools that was not protected from damage from motor vehicles accessing other areas in the development.    Violation observed on or about February 6, 2016

29 CFR 1926.451(b)(1): Platform(s) on all working levels of scaffolds, were not fully planked or decked between the front uprights and guardrail supports:   a. Montgomery Ridge Development, Autumn Lane, Skillman, NJ - Bldg 801  The employer did not ensure that all working levels of a welded tubular frame scaffold were fully planked prior to use.  Employees were observed working from a single tier scaffold that was not fully planked from the front uprights to the guardrail supports.   Violation observed on or about February 6, 2016

29 CFR 1926.451(c)(2): Supported scaffold poles, legs, posts, frames, and uprights did not bear on base plates and mud sills or other adequate firm foundation:   a. Montgomery Ridge Development, Autumn Lane, Skillman, NJ - Bldg 801  Employees engaged in masonry activities used a welded tubular frame scaffold, erected on a mud and rock foundation, without the use of mud sills to provide a firm foundation.   Violation observed on or about February 6, 2016

29 CFR 1926.451(c)(3): Supported scaffold poles, legs, post, frames, and/or uprights were not plumb and braced to prevent swaying and displacement:  a. Montgomery Ridge Development, Autumn Lane, Skillman, NJ - Bldg 801  Employees engaged in masonry activities used a welded tubular frame scaffold that was not fully braced.  The employer did not ensure that cross bracing was installed on both sides of the scaffold to ensure the scaffold was plumb and braced to prevent swaying or collapse, prior to use.   Violation observed on or about February 6, 2016
